The ventrolateral medulla (VLM) modulates autonomic functions, motor reactions and pain responses. The lateralmost part of the caudal VLM (VLMlat) was recently shown to be the VLM area responsible for pain modulation. CENTRAL CHEMORECEPTION refers to detection of CO2/pH within the brain and the subsequent reflex effects on breathing. It involves multiple sites within the hindbrain (9, 12, 19) as focal acidification in vivo uniquely at these sites stimulates breathing, indicating detection and chemoreflex initiation. The raphe magnus is part of an interrelated region of medullary raphe and ventromedial reticular nuclei that project to all areas of the spinal gray. Activation of raphe and reticular neurons evokes modulatory effects in sensory, autonomic, and motor spinal processes. This paper analyzes differences in welfare utilization between immigrants and natives in Sweden using a large panel data set for the years 1990 to 1996. We find that immigrants use welfare to a greater extent than natives and that differences cannot be explained by observable characteristics. Welfare participation decreases with time spent in Sweden.
